Job summary

Columbus Consolidated Government is seeking an Athletic Programs Administrator to plan, organize, and oversee adult recreational activities. The role includes meetings, rule creation, fee collection, and coordinating schedules and tournaments.

You will train and supervise athletic staff, monitor budgets, and liaise with youth organizations, vendors, and schools to ensure safe, compliant programming. This position requires strong communication and organizational skills.

Qualifications

  • Experience in athletic facility and program management.
  • Ability to supervise and train staff.
  • Knowledge of budgetary administration.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ills.
  • Valid Georgia driver's license or ability to obtain one.

Responsibilities

  • Plan, organize, and oversee adult recreational programs.
  • Conduct organizational meetings, create rules, collect fees.
  • Coordinate schedules and tournament brackets.
  • Register teams with national organizations.
  • Update division website with schedules, standings, photos.
  • Train, supervise, and direct athletic staff.
  • Monitor budgetary monies and ensure vendor payments.
  • Liaise with volunteer youth sports organizations.
  • Recruit and oversee special events.
  • Schedule and collect fees for youth coach certification classes.
  • Process work order requests.
  • Monitor facilities for safety.
  • Coordinate with Muscogee County School District for events.
  • Perform other related duties.
